Jon Woolcott

Jon Woolcott is a writer and publisher, who has lived in Dorset for twelve years, and grew up nearby in southern Wiltshire. He currently works for the acclaimed independent publisher, Little Toller, where he also edits The Clearing, the online journal for new writing about place and nature. He has been Communications Officer for Cranborne Chase AONB, (straddling Dorset, Wiltshire and Somerset), and held senior marketing and buying roles for Stanfords, Waterstones and Ottakar’s. His writing, which often focuses on Dorset, has appeared widely, including for The Guardian, Caught by the River, The Bookseller, Sightly Foxed, Echtrai Journal and History Press.

 Jon Woolcott will be talking about his new book Real Dorset (Seren 2023), the latest in Seren's 'Real' Series. Real Dorset is a personal, detailed, discursive, humorous and idiosyncratic look at the county famous for its spectacular coastline, for its historic towns, its eco foodie reputation, for Hardy and Fowles.
